Lorene E Rainwater 1917 - 1993

Lorene E Rainwater of Rossville, Walker County, GA was born on October 31, 1917, and died at age 76 years old on November 28, 1993. Lorene Rainwater was buried at Chattanooga National Cemetery Section CC Site 707 1200 Bailey Avenue, in Chattanooga, Tn.

In 1917, in the year that Lorene E Rainwater was born, Dutch exotic dancer Mata Hari was convicted and executed as a German spy. Since Mata Hari, born Margaretha Geertruida "Margreet" MacLeod, was a citizen of the Netherlands (which remained neutral in World War 1), she could travel freely in Europe. Her travels (and her romantic entanglements) raised suspicion and she was arrested by the French and found guilty. There is still controversy about her guilt although her name has become synonymous with a seductive female spy.

In 1925, by the time she was only 8 years old, on November 28th, radio station WSM broadcast the Grand Ole Opry for the first time. Originally airing as “The WSM Barn Dance”, the Opry (a local term for "opera") was dedicated to honoring country music and in its history has featured the biggest stars and acts in country music.
